But what is title insurance and precisely why is it important, you ask? Let us break down the points.
To start with, a title company validates the legitimacy of a real estate title. They are required players in making certain and protecting the rightful ownership of the purchaser as he or maybe she acquires a property. To make sure that the name is legitimate, the company does a thorough search and examination of records and papers so as to Paul Caver find out that no other party stake a claim on the property being sold.
The title insurance also functions to this end. The title search, no matter how complete, is not a hundred % faultless. A title insurance policy safeguards the interests of both buyer as well as lender in the unfortunate occasion that any dispute over the ownership of the property arises down the road. These disputes rarely occur, but when they do, the legitimate fees and economic repercussions are huge burdens. It won't hurt to be ready.
There are 2 kinds of title insurance policies. The lender's as well as the buyer's insurance. Some lenders may only require one - the lender's coverage, but we recommend you buy both. As stated, a little foresight goes a very long way. If sometime in the future, someone says to be the rightful owner of your house and it's proved that the title is really wrong, the title company is obligated to pay you and the lender the amounts you invested and lent for the home respectively.
